Output dd34ceec51415bb1c6f78f81f34ca8cb34dc2e625a83a6674a57ce432469ea02:19

value
51511281
script pubkey
OP_0 OP_PUSHBYTES_20 5e403e9b36210c16a1fd7f7d2040c55f507ec6ef
address
ltc1qteqraxekyyxpdg0a0a7jqsx9tag8a3h0w3wwa5
transaction
dd34ceec51415bb1c6f78f81f34ca8cb34dc2e625a83a6674a57ce432469ea02
spent
true